Russia is expected to add planned working gas capacity additions of 634 billion cubic feet (bcf) by 2025, while announced projects account for the remaining 179 bcf.

China is the second highest contributor to global working gas capacity additions, with planned capacity additions of 473 bcf by 2025.

They seem to understand the necessity of investing in additional capacity additions to help the country effectively meet peak demand and decrease LNG imports during the winter season.
